Allow an IngressRoute for TCP forwarding but without a `tls` section which implicitly configures it as a TLS Passthrough. TLS Passthrough only reads the very first TLS packets and routes the traffic without doing any kind of TLS termination. The chosen `virtualhost` is discovered by reading the TLS SNI (Server Name Indication) extension. Close projectcontour#15

Hello, it would be good to know whether Contour supports ssl passthrough and if it doesn't - whether it would be possible/reasonable to add it.
NGINX ingress controller has this
ingress.kubernetes.io/ssl-passthrough: "true"
annotation, it might make sense to keep the format the same to make it easier to switch between ingresses.The text was updated successfully, but these errors were encountered:
